Payoneer Global Inc is the world's go-to partner for digital commerce, everywhere. The company started as a cross-border payments platform that empowers businesses, online sellers, and freelancers. The platform allows the users to get paid in multiple currencies, bill global clients, and sell on marketplaces worldwide.

The firm's products are sold through about 1,400 company-operated stores, wholesale channels, and e-commerce in North America (67% of fiscal 2022 sales), Europe, Asia (28% of fiscal 2022 sales), and elsewhere. Coach (74% of fiscal 2022 sales) is best known for affordable luxury leather products. Kate Spade (22% of fiscal 2022 sales) is known for colorful patterns and graphics. Women's handbags and accessories produced 69% of Tapestry's sales in fiscal 2022. Stuart Weitzman, Tapestry's smallest brand, generates nearly all its revenue from women's footwear.
